JOHN O'BRYAN
v.
JANET O'BRYAN
v.
JANET O'BRYAN
SC 16666.
Supreme Court of Connecticut.
Jan 3, 2002.
Brenden P. Leydon, in support of the petition.
Cited by 1 opinion | Published
The plaintiffs petition for certification for appeal from the Appellate Court, 67 Conn. App. 51 (AC 20825), is granted, limited to the following issue:
“Did the Appellate Court properly conclude that the trial court did not have authority, under General Statutes § 46b-66, to modify the postmajorify child support provision by requiring that a portion of it be paid directly to the child?”
